WebGive examples of the kind of information that a tax practitioner might want to obtain. 1) The client's tax entity (ies). 2) The client's family status and stability. 3) The client's past, present, and projected marginal tax rates. 4) The client's legal domicile and citizenship. 5) The client's motivation for the transaction. WebJan 1, 2024 · Problem No. 2: Failure to obtain signed Form 8879 before submitting the return. The practitioner does not have authorization to electronically submit the return until a signed Form 8879 is received. The taxpayer's signature should be dated on or before the date the ERO submits the return.
